Do you purge after a HydraFacial?

Does your skin purge after HydraFacial®? Although the chemical exfoliation used in a HydraFacial® is quite mild, the combination of hydradermabrasion, exfoliating acids such as salicylic, and suction may accelerate the movement of deeper impurities in the skin, creating a “purge” effect.

Does your face peel after a HydraFacial?

After 3-5 days there may be some mild skin shedding and peeling. Due to the mild AHA/BHA peels within the Hydrafacial treatment, it may produce a microscopic shedding of the outer dead skin layer which is not visible to the naked eye. The presence or absence of visible peeling does not impact the final results.

What comes out during a HydraFacial?

It releases a vacuum-powered stream of Activ-4 serum. This serum is made of lactic and glycolic acid, which work together to cleanse and dislodge any dirt and oils that are stuck inside your pores.

How long does purging last after a HydraFacial?

Carol: Not everyone experiences skin purging when they get a HydraFacial, but it can happen. The salicylic acid used is a decongestant which draws out bacteria that builds up in the pores. So, if you have a lot of congestion then you may experience skin purging. It can last a few days and clears up on its own.

Do and don'ts after HydraFacial?

HydraFacial Post-Care Instructions:

Avoid any exfoliation to the area for 48 hours post-treatment. To keep the area clean, avoid heat sources, including hot showers, saunas, and cardio workouts that may produce sweat for 24 hours.

What do dermatologists say about hydrafacials?

Hydrafacials are effective at deep cleaning the skin, exfoliating the skin, and improving skin tone and texture. As for acne, Dr. Rogers says its "fine but not a miracle worker—it does not do much for the active lesions but by unclogging pores it can help prevent further breakouts," she adds.
